Output e6305bd569e565dde4e56cc8aa4cc5d841be1e9e910a82c8e20fcd32e976e20a:1

value
236199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dabd5cabbe39c2ab52d5a50ad1feac1a477657c1 OP_EQUAL
address
3Mdc5TvAviPrdyLpjHjyK2WcVf6avxSh5P
transaction
e6305bd569e565dde4e56cc8aa4cc5d841be1e9e910a82c8e20fcd32e976e20a
confirmations
119711
spent
true